Setting the channel

To do this open the battery compartment on
the back of the outdoor sensor and take it off.

Set the channel by means of the Channel
selection switch

39

.

Press the channel button

26

for approx. 3

seconds until a signal is sounded. The wea-
ther station has now received one signal.

Press the TX button

42

to transmit the measured

temperature to the weather station manually.

Then close the battery compartment

40

.

Displaying the outdoor
temperature

Press the Channel button

26

to display the

outdoor temperature of each outdoor sensor.

– Press the Channel button

26

1 x to display

channel 1.

– Press the Channel button

26

2 x to display

channel 2.

– Press the Channel button

26

3 x to display

channel 3.

– Press the Channel button

26

4 x to display

all the channels one after the other in a loop.
Only the outdoor sensors which can be
addressed are displayed.

Press and hold down the Channel button

26

to remove unused channels. If a further out-
door sensor and channel are added later,
the weather station will receive the signal
automatically. Alternatively, you can also
transmit the initial signal from the outdoor
sensor manually by pressing the TX button

42

.

Displaying the air humidity

(indoor)

The current air humidity

5

is shown in the LC

display. The Comfort indicator

4

displays the

air humidity in three categories.

The following categories are available:

“Dry”

= Air humidity

5

< 45 %

“Comfort” = Air humidity

5

45–75 %,

indoor temperature

3

24 °C–27.9 °C

“Wet”

= Air humidity

5

> 75 %

Displaying the maximum /
minimum temperature /
humidity

The minimum / maximum temperature / humidity is
measured for the first time after the batteries have
been inserted and stored in the weather station.

Press the “–“ / MAX / MIN button

29

briefly.

The maximum indoor

3

and outdoor tem-

perature

24

measured and the maximum

humidity

5

measured are shown.

Press the “–“ / MAX / MIN button

29

again

briefly. The minimum indoor

3

and outdoor

temperature

24

measured and the minimum

humidity

5

measured are shown.

Press the “–“ / MAX / MIN button

29

again

briefly to return to the current values.

Note: If no button is pressed within 5 seconds,
the displays automatically return to the
standard display.

Hold the “–“ / MAX / MIN button

29

down

for approx. 3 seconds in order to delete the
stored maximum and minimum values when
you hear a beep sound. The values measured
from the time of deletion of the old values
until the next time the memory is called up
can be called up again.
